关于 HTML <a> 标签的问题
时间: 2023-11-09 11:07:43 浏览: 46
好的,HTML <a> 标签通常用于创建链接,使用户能够在网页上从一个页面跳转到另一个页面或在同一页面内的不同部分之间进行导航。以下是一些关于 HTML <a> 标签的常见问题和答案:
1. 如何使用 <a> 标签创建一个链接?
在 HTML 中,您可以使用以下语法创建一个链接:
```
<a href="目标网址">链接文本</a>
```
其中,`href` 属性指定链接的目标网址,链接文本是用户可见的文本。
2. 如何为链接添加样式?
您可以使用 CSS 来为链接添加样式,例如更改链接文本的颜色、字体、背景颜色等。可以使用 `:link`、`:visited`、`:hover` 和 `:active` 伪类选择器来设置链接的不同状态下的样式。
3. 如何在新窗口中打开链接?
您可以使用 `target` 属性来指定链接应该在新窗口中打开。例如:
```
<a href="目标网址" target="_blank">链接文本</a>
```
4. 如何创建一个锚点链接?
锚点链接可以让用户在同一页面内的不同部分之间进行导航。要创建一个锚点链接,请在链接的 `href` 属性中使用 `#` 加上锚点名称,例如:
```
<a href="#section1">跳转到第一节</a>
```
然后,在页面中添加一个带有相同名称的锚点,例如:
```
<h2 id="section1">第一节</h2>
```
相关问题
<li><a><b>登录</b></a> <div class=“向下”> <呃> <li></li> </ul> </div></li>的class标签为down的div找到<a>标签
这个HTML代码片段描述了一个包含登录链接和下拉菜单的结构。具体来说,`<li>`标签内嵌套了`<a>`标签,`<a>`标签内部还有一个`<b>`标签,表示"登录"。`<div class="向下">`是一个具有"向下"类的`<div>`元素,它包含了另一个`<li>`标签和一个嵌套的`<ul>`标签。
要找到`class`为"向下"的`<div>`元素内部的`<a>`标签,你可以直接引用它的路径,因为`<a>`标签是直接在`<div>`内的。代码如下:
```html
<div class="向下">
<a>
<b>登录</b>
</a>
<!-- 其他内容 -->
</div>
```
如果你想用JavaScript或CSS来选择这个元素,你可以使用以下代码:
**JavaScript:**
```javascript
var anchor = document.querySelector('div.down > a');
```
**CSS (假设HTML文档加载完成后):**
```css
.down a {
/* 选择器规则 */
}
```
在这个例子中,`> a`选择器表示只选择`div`直接子元素中的`<a>`标签。
1.设计一个网页,使用内联语义元素<a> <br> <del> <ins> <mark> <span> <sub><sup>,重点为<a>标签。必须包含跳转到其他网站、本网站的其他网页。
设计一个网页需要遵循HTML语言的基本规则和语法,其中内联语义元素<a> <br> <del> <ins> <mark> <span> <sub><sup>可以用于设置文本的样式和语义。其中,<a>标签是用于创建超链接的标签,可以跳转到其他网站或本网站的其他网页。下面是一个简单的网页设计示例,重点为<a>标签:
<!DOCTYPE html>
<html>
<head>
<title>我的网页</title>
</head>
<body>
<h1>欢迎来到我的网页</h1>
<p>这是一个关于<a href="https://www.baidu.com">百度</a>的链接。</p>
<p>这是一个关于<a href="otherpage.html">本网站的其他网页</a>的链接。</p>
<p>这是一个包含<a href="https://www.baidu.com"><span style="color:red">红色字体</span></a>的链接。</p>
<p>这是一个包含<a href="https://www.baidu.com"><img src="image.jpg" alt="图片"></a>的链接。</p>
</body>
</html>
在这个示例中,我们使用了<a>标签来创建超链接,其中href属性指定了链接的目标地址。我们还使用了<span>标签来设置文本的颜色,<img>标签来插入图片。这些标签都是内联元素,可以在文本中嵌套使用。